Exactly How Does Stress And Anxiety Reason Acne?
Acne can be caused or intensified by stress and anxiety, specifically when it includes hormonal fluctuations that prompt excess oil production and clogged up pores. It can additionally be aggravated by missing a skin treatment programs, eating junk foods and neglecting to consume sufficient water.
Determining and taking care of triggers can help. Try keeping a journal to track when your outbreaks take place and what seems to help or intensify them.
Hormonal agents
Hormone acne prevails during adolescence, menstrual cycle cycles, maternity and menopause due to the fact that hormonal agent levels vary. This results in a modification in the manufacturing of oily materials called sebum and the hairs that have actually follicles attached to them. The roots create sebum to secure and oil the skin. When these glands generate way too much, they can clog the pores with dirt, dead skin cells and germs and trigger acne to show up.
This kind of acne has a tendency to impact females greater than males. It additionally shows up on the cheeks, chest, shoulders and back because these areas have more hair follicles and oil glands than other parts of the body.
Hormonal acne typically enhances as you enter your thirties, however many individuals still experience outbreaks right into their 40s and past. It commonly originates from changes in the degrees of estrogen and progesterone during menstrual cycle cycles, maternity and menopause. It might additionally be brought on by particular medications. Hormonal acne can be worsened by using makeup, which can obstruct pores.

Way of living
It is a recognized fact that acne flare extra throughout stressful times and that stress and anxiety can make existing outbreaks worse. This is because high levels of stress and anxiety hormonal agents can result in a variety of hormone discrepancies that cause overflow of oil, which can better block pores and set off an acne flare-up. Along with that, individuals under a lot of stress often tend to rest less, consume junk foods and overlook their skin care regimens, which can all contribute to acne episodes.
Whether you are taking care of acne or not, reducing lasting anxiety can help boost your general health and lower the danger of many problems, including heart disease, stroke, cancer cells and weight problems. Some strategies to attempt include reflection, yoga, deep breathing exercises and obtaining enough rest. A healthy diet regimen that is reduced in sugar and fatty foods, and contains high-grade proteins and vegetables will certainly also sustain your skin health.
Although stress and anxiety doesn't offer you acne, it can make outbreaks worse if you are currently predisposed to them with genetics and ever-changing levels of androgen hormonal agents during the age of puberty, pregnancy and menopause along with taking specific medications like lithium or corticosteroids. Skin Treatment
Acne can worsen when individuals skip skin treatment regimens or utilize bothersome skincare items during times of anxiety. Stress might also trigger people to smoke or pick at their acnes, which can make them red and swollen. Exactly exactly how stress makes acne worse is not totally understood, however experts believe that cortisol and adrenaline trigger oil glands to generate more sebum, or natural oils. This excess sebum blends with dead skin cells and bacteria to block pores, creating pimples and cysts.
Moderate stress-related acne usually responds to over the counter topical therapies including benzoyl peroxide and salicylic acid. If your outbreaks become severe or relentless, you should speak with a skin doctor for more intensive therapies. A skin doctor can prescribe skin treatment items or prescription drugs that can clear the skin faster, consisting of oral and topical retinoids and antibiotics.
